Midwifery interns will collaborate with experienced midwives and obstetricians in hospitals and birthing centers worldwide. They will assist in prenatal care, labor and delivery, and postpartum care for mothers and infants. Interns will also observe and participate in patient education and community health programs.

IMA partners with a variety of public and private healthcare facilities to offer diverse and rewarding internship placements for our Midwifery interns. Depending on your specific interests and skills, you may have the opportunity to work in settings such as:
Hospitals
Work alongside experienced midwives and obstetricians to provide prenatal care, manage labor and delivery, and address postpartum issues.
Clinics
Assist in outpatient settings where you will support women through all stages of pregnancy, conduct routine examinations, and provide education on maternal health.
Community Health Programs
Participate in community outreach initiatives aimed at improving maternal and neonatal health for underserved populations. This includes conducting health screenings, educational workshops, and vaccination drives.
Specialized Centers
Depending on your interests and the needs of the host community, you may also work in centers specializing in areas such as high-risk pregnancies, neonatal care, or family planning.
